分享更有价值
被信任是一种快乐

怎么实现slave集群负载均衡

文章页正文上

这篇文章主要讲解了“怎么实现slave集群负载均衡”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“怎么实现slave集群负载均衡”吧!一.介绍
由于互联网系统读的压力要远大于写的压力,因此该软件主要实现分散压力,负载均衡的功能。
– 四层负载均衡(TCPIP协议的负载均衡)
haproxy lvs

– 七层负载均衡(http协议的负载均衡)
nginx

二.结构图

三.安装配置haproxy
1.免费主机域名将安装包上传
haproxy-1.7.9.tar.gz

2.编译安装
tar -xzvf haproxy-1.7.9.tar.gz
– 查看内核版本
# uname -r
2.6.32-696.el6.x86_64

– 根据内核版本进行编译

yum install gcc*
make TARGET=linux26PREFIX=/usr/local/haproxy ARCH=X86_64
make install PREFIX=/usr/local/haproxy

# /usr/local/haproxy/sbin/haproxy -v
HA-Proxy version 1.7.9 2017/08/18
Copyright 2000-2017 Willy Tarreau

3.建立haproxy用户
useradd haproxy
chown -R haproxy.haproxy /usr/local/haproxy

4.配置
– 复制haproxy文件到/usr/sbin下
因为下面的haproxy.init启动脚本默认会去/usr/sbin下找,当然你也可以修改,不过比较麻烦。
cp /usr/local/haproxy/sbin/haproxy /usr/sbin/

– 复制haproxy脚本,免费主机域名到/etc/init.d下
cp /tmp/haproxy-1.7.9/examples/haproxy.init /etc/init.d/haproxy
chmod 755 /etc/init.d/haproxy

– 创建配置文件
mkdir /etc/haproxy
vi /etc/haproxy/haproxy.cfg

.conf 去掉下面两列的注释
$ModLoad imudp
$UDPServerRun 514
然后添加下面的行
local1.* /var/log/haproxy.log

重启rsyslog
# service rsyslog restart
Shutting down system logger: [ OK ]
Starting system logger: [ OK ]

5.启动haproxy
在管理server上添加vip
ifconfig eth0:0 192.168.1.208
service haproxy start

四.测试负载均衡
1.数据库连接
点击(此处)折叠或打开
[root@mysql5 ~]# mysql -uroot -p -h 192.168.1.208 -P 3307 -e “select @@hostname”
Enter password:
+————+
| @@hostname |
+————+
| mysql5.7 |
+————+
[root@mysql5 ~]# mysql -uroot -p -h 192.168.1.208 -P 3307 -e “select @@hostname”
Enter password:
+————+
| @@hostname |
+————+
| mysql5.7-2 |
+————+
[root@mysql5 ~]# mysql -uroot -p -h 192.168.1.208 -P 3307 -e “select @@hostname”
Enter password:
+————+
| @@hostname |
+————+
| mysql5.7-3 |
+————+
[root@mysql5 ~]# mysql -uroot -p -h 192.168.1.208 -P 3307 -e “select @@hostname”
Enter password:
+————+
| @@hostname |
+————+
| mysql5.7 |
+————+
2.登陆网页
http://192.168.1.208:48800/admin-status
感谢各位的阅读,以上就是“怎么实现slave集群负载均衡”的内容了,经过本文的学习后,相信大家对怎么实现slave集群负载均衡这一问题有了更深刻的体会,具体使用情况还需要大家实践验证。这里是云技术,小编将为大家推送更多相关知识点的文章,欢迎关注!

相关推荐: sql2000报错Successfully re-opened the local eventlog的解决方法

本篇内容介绍了“sql2000报错Successfully re-opened the local eventlog的解决方法”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能…

文章页内容下
赞(0) 打赏
版权声明:本站采用知识共享、学习交流,不允许用于商业用途;文章由发布者自行承担一切责任,与本站无关。
文章页正文下
文章页评论上

云服务器、web空间可免费试用

宝塔面板主机、支持php,mysql等,SSL部署;安全高速企业专供99.999%稳定,另有高防主机、不限制内容等类型,具体可咨询QQ:360163164,Tel同微信:18905205712

主机选购导航云服务器试用

登录

找回密码

注册